
US federal investigators closed parallel felony and civil probes into prediction market Polymarket, issuing letters earlier this month that ended inquiries by each the Justice Division and the Commodity Futures Buying and selling Fee (CFTC), as Bloomberg Information reported.
The platform permits merchants to wager on yes-or-no outcomes utilizing stablecoins on Polygon and has confronted scrutiny since a January 2022 CFTC settlement required it to exclude US clients.
Investigators later examined whether or not American customers continued to wager via digital non-public networks.
Polymarket processed roughly $2.6 billion in quantity throughout November’s US election season, drawing legislation‑enforcement consideration as buying and selling spiked.
Regulatory reset
Brokers escalated the matter eight days after the November vote, raiding CEO Shayne Coplan’s SoHo condominium and seizing his cellphone.
Coplan denounced the search as an overreach tied to the outgoing Biden staff’s stance on digital asset corporations.
In a July 15 submit on X, Coplan stated the platform “cooperated and engaged” with authorities and “has been cleared of any wrongdoing,” including that “justice prevailed.”
The choice to shut the probes aligns with a broader coverage shift.
Capitol Hill has labeled the present legislative push “Crypto Week,” and Congress plans a Home flooring vote that would ship the primary complete crypto invoice to President Donald Trump for signature.
In line with the report, the White Home has additionally tapped enterprise capital govt and former CFTC Commissioner Brian Quintenz to return and lead the derivatives regulator, signaling a friendlier method to oversight for prediction markets.
Path to licensed US market
With the investigations resolved, the report highlighted that Polymarket can now discover formal re-entry into the US.
Choices embody making use of to function as a delegated contract market or buying an entity that already holds a CFTC license.
The agency has lately introduced a partnership with X and xAI to ship on-platform occasion forecasts, strikes that would help growth below a compliant framework.
Polymarket initially agreed to pay $1.4 million and delist three markets to settle the 2022 CFTC motion.
Firm engineers then put in geofencing instruments, though regulators questioned whether or not US merchants have been nonetheless accessing its web site.
The closure letters point out that investigators discovered no proof of breaches of earlier obligations, clearing a major hurdle earlier than any licensing software.
For now, Polymarket’s clearance removes fast authorized threat whereas lawmakers talk about new guidelines.
